  3. perkman1969

    Mk3 Cupra R alcantara wheel

    I’ve fitted one from Mewant - it’s for the golf and apart from small areas not covered and the need for some extra padding underneath it on the lower quarters, it fits really nicely, and more importantly it feels amazing, especially in this freezing weather. Thickens the wheel too, which I like...

  15. perkman1969

    Eco Mode Issue?

    Easiest way to test it is see if the coasting function is still active- when you lift your foot off the accelerator down a hill for instance, the car defaults to idle speed until you press the accelerator again. Only eco mode has the coast function I believe. Sent from my iPhone using Tapatalk
